The Process: Effectively Conducting a Door Handle Repair Replacement

Conducting a door handle repair replacement is a crucial aspect of customer satisfaction in any auto body shop, as it directly impacts the overall user experience. The process requires meticulous attention to detail and a systematic approach to ensure both functionality and aesthetics are restored. An expert technician begins by thoroughly inspecting the damaged handle, identifying the specific issue, and gathering the necessary tools and parts—a critical step often overlooked but essential for efficient and accurate repairs.
In many cases, collision damage repair involves complex auto body repair techniques, especially when addressing door handles. For instance, a bent or broken door handle armrest may require precise metalworking to straighten and reinstall, while a worn-out handle mechanism could demand the replacement of multiple components. It is here that a skilled technician’s experience becomes invaluable, as they can quickly diagnose and resolve issues others might overlook.
Effective communication with the customer throughout the process is key. Keeping them informed about the repair’s progress, expected completion time, and potential additional costs fosters transparency and trust. For example, if a door handle replacement involves more extensive auto body repair due to collision damage, a well-informed customer can make informed decisions regarding their vehicle’s restoration. A satisfied customer is not only one who receives a fully functional door handle but also one who appreciates the care and expertise invested in the repair process.
